Transaction 4cfbfbc8034d81619e39efd694e2669e6f675930c99560dfc49bbe15ad21d44c

2 Input
2 Outputs
  • 4cfbfbc8034d81619e39efd694e2669e6f675930c99560dfc49bbe15ad21d44c:0
  • value  5066247
    address  38SHJeWXuMsBQvWEmnNr5EFhLbAPNiqEED
  • 4cfbfbc8034d81619e39efd694e2669e6f675930c99560dfc49bbe15ad21d44c:1
  • value  1068284
    address  38bvi8LtnPLminCM6SXA5zv3zC5NWWNMTB